Is It Up to You Whether You Are Happy or Unhappy? ~Small Spectacular Views Found in a Single Life in the Countryside in My 40s~

Who decides whether you are happy or unhappy?

“That person is unhappy.”
“Such circumstances are pitiful.”

There certainly exist what are called “unhappy circumstances” in society that invite sympathy from anyone who sees them.
But does the person in that environment feel unhappy 24 hours a day, 365 days a year?

I do not believe that is the case.
No matter what situation you are in, there must be moments when you suddenlyfeel happy.

A “spectacular view” found in an ordinary daily life with a cat, single in my 40s

My own life is by no means the kind of glamorous one that everyone envies.
I am in my 40s and single. I live in an ordinary studio apartment in the countryside. I live there quietly with one cat.

If you fit it into the general societal framework of “success” or an “ideal lifestyle,” I might be classified as a “lonely person” or an “unhappy person.”

I myself do not think for a moment that my life is as dramatic as the protagonist of a movie or drama.
However, even in my ordinary and sometimes boring daily life, a moment recently arrived when I could truly think from the heart,“Ah, I am happy.”

It was a truly casual scene from daily life.
When I was spending time in my room as usual, I suddenly noticed that the western sky was dyed remarkably red.
Curious, I looked up at the sky as if to look back.

There, a spectacular view spread out that made me hold my breath and gaze in fascination.
A burning sunset sky. As I stared at that beautiful gradation, I felt my heart become calm and fulfilled.

A time spent just gazing at the twilight sky.“What a luxurious and happy moment this is.”I was able to think that naturally.

If you have the “mental space” to feel happy, the world will change

What exactly is “happiness”?
Having a fine house? Being surrounded by family? Having a lot of money?

Of course, those are also forms of happiness. However, that is not everything.
I think that whether you think you are happy or unhappy is, in the end, “up to you.”

If you decide from the beginning that your environment is “unhappy,” you cannot notice the small joys that should be there.
That is why I want you to have themental space to feel happyin the unexpected moments of your daily life.

Even though you might overlook it because your days are busy or you feel crushed by anxiety. Just by changing your perspective a little, or just by stopping in your tracks, seeds of happiness are scattered all around us.

A beautiful sunset, the sleeping face of my beloved cat, the moment I enjoy the fish I caught myself...

If there is someone who is pessimistic about their situation right now, I want them to take a deep breath and look around.

When you can relax your heart just a little and have some space, you will surely be able to see your own “spectacular view” in your daily life as well.
